滚转对用CCD组合测量弹目相对方位的影响

摘    要:针对减旋机构的滚转角偏差会影响利用CCD组合测量弹目相对方位的精度,建立了描述转角偏差与弹目相对方位测量误差关系的数学模型,进行了仿真和试验,分析了仿真和试验结果.结果表明,转角偏差对弹目相对方位的测量精度影响较大,减旋机构的旋转控制精度是决定转角偏差大小的主要因素,转角偏差不宜超过5°.

Influence of Rotation on Relative Orientation Between Projectile and Target Measured by CCD

Abstract:The rotation angle error affects the measuring precision of relative orientation between projectile and target by Charge Coupled Device(CCD).Aiming at the problem,the error model was built by which the relationship between the rotation angle error and the relative orientation was described.Based on the model,simulation models and tests were designed.The results show that the rotation angle error affects the measuring precision.The control precision of electromotor is the key factor of controlling the error,...
